public static interface SourceDescription.Builder extends SdkPojo, CopyableBuilder<SourceDescription.Builder,SourceDescription>
| Modifier and Type | Method and Description |
|---|---|
default SourceDescription.Builder |
kinesisStreamSourceDescription(Consumer<KinesisStreamSourceDescription.Builder> kinesisStreamSourceDescription)
The KinesisStreamSourceDescription value for the source Kinesis data stream.
|
SourceDescription.Builder |
kinesisStreamSourceDescription(KinesisStreamSourceDescription kinesisStreamSourceDescription)
The KinesisStreamSourceDescription value for the source Kinesis data stream.
|
copyapplyMutation, buildSourceDescription.Builder kinesisStreamSourceDescription(KinesisStreamSourceDescription kinesisStreamSourceDescription)
The KinesisStreamSourceDescription value for the source Kinesis data stream.
kinesisStreamSourceDescription - The KinesisStreamSourceDescription value for the source Kinesis data stream.default SourceDescription.Builder kinesisStreamSourceDescription(Consumer<KinesisStreamSourceDescription.Builder> kinesisStreamSourceDescription)
The KinesisStreamSourceDescription value for the source Kinesis data stream.
This is a convenience that creates an instance of theKinesisStreamSourceDescription.Builder avoiding
the need to create one manually via KinesisStreamSourceDescription.builder().
When the Consumer completes, SdkBuilder.build() is called
immediately and its result is passed to
kinesisStreamSourceDescription(KinesisStreamSourceDescription).kinesisStreamSourceDescription - a consumer that will call methods on KinesisStreamSourceDescription.BuilderkinesisStreamSourceDescription(KinesisStreamSourceDescription)Copyright © 2017 Amazon Web Services, Inc. All Rights Reserved.